Technical Features
Sealed Construction
Yuasa’s unique construction and sealing technique ensures no electrolyte leakage from case or terminals.
Electrolyte Suspension System
All NP batteries utilize Yuasa’s unique electrolyte susp ension system incorporating a microfine glass ma t to ret ai n th e maximum amount of electrolyte in the cells. The electrolyte is retained in the separator material and there is no fr ee electrolyte to escape from the cells. No gels or other contaminants are added.
Control of Gas Generation
The design of Yuasa’s NP batteries incorporates the very latest oxygen recombination technology to effectively control the generation of gas during normal use.
Low Maintenance Operation
Due to the perfectly sealed construction and the recombination of gasses within the cell, the battery is almost maintenance free.

Operation in any Orientation
The combination of sealed construction and Yuasa’s unique electrolyte suspension system allows oper ation in any orientation, with no loss of performance or fear of electrolyte leakage.
Valve Regulated Design
The batteries are equipped with a simple, safe, low pressure venting system which releases excess gas and automatically reseals should there be a build up of gas within t he bat tery due to se ve re ov e rc ha r ge . N o te . O n n o account should the battery be charged in a sealed container.

Lead Calcium Grids
The heavy duty lead calcium alloy grids provide an extra margin of performance and life in both cyclic and float applications and give unparalleled recovery from deep discharge.
Long Cycle Service Life
Depending upon the average depth of discharge, over a thousand discharge/charge cycles can be expected.
Float Service Life
The expected service life is five years in float standby applications.
Separators
The use of the special separator material provides a very efficient insulation between plates preve nting inter-p late short circuits and prohibiting the shedding of active materials.
Long shelf Life
The extremely low self discharge rate allows the battery to be stored for extended periods up to one year at normal ambient temperatures with no permanent loss of capacity.
Operating Temperature Range
The batteries can be used over a broad temperature range permitting considerable flexibility in system design and location.
Charge – 15°C to 50°C Discharge – 20°C to 60°C Storage – 20°C to 50°C (fully charged battery)
